Storage & Reheating Tips
Refrigerator
Store pancakes in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
Freezer
Freeze for up to 2 months.
Reheating
Warm pancakes in:
-
A toaster
-
Microwave for 20–30 seconds
-
Oven at 325°F for 5 minutes

Healthy / Special Diet Option
These pancakes can fit many diets.
-
Vegan: Replace the egg with a flax egg
-
Gluten-free: Use certified gluten-free oats
-
High protein: Add a scoop of vanilla protein powder

Oatmeal Blender Apple Carrot Pancakes
Ingredients
- 1½ cups rolled oats
- 1 small apple grated
- ½ cup grated carrot
- 1 cup milk any type
- 1 large egg
- 1 tablespoon melted butter or coconut oil
- 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
Instructions
- Add rolled oats, milk, egg, honey (or maple syrup), vanilla extract, baking powder, cinnamon, and nutmeg to a blender.
- Blend until the oats break down and the mixture becomes a smooth pancake batter.
- Transfer the batter to a bowl and gently stir in the grated apple and grated carrot.
- Let the batter rest for 5 minutes so the oats absorb some liquid.
- Heat a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ium heat and lightly grease with oil or butter.
- Pour about ¼ cup of batter onto the skillet for each pancake.
- Cook for 2–3 minutes until bubbles appear on the surface.
- Flip the pancake and cook for 1–2 minutes more until golden brown.
- Repeat with the remaining batter and serve warm.
Notes
- Blend the oats thoroughly to create a smooth batter texture.
- Allow the batter to rest briefly so the oats soften and the pancakes cook evenly.
- Cook over medium heat to prevent burning while allowing the inside to cook through.
- These pancakes freeze well and can be reheated in a toaster or microwave.
